#605c53 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#605c53 is composed of 37.6% red, 36.1%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 4.2% magenta, 13.5% yellow and 62.4% black. It has a hue angle of 41.5 degrees, a saturation of 7.3% and a lightness of 35.1%. #605c53 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0b8a6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#605c53 color description : Very dark grayish orange.
#605c53 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#605c53 has RGB values of R:96, G:92,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.04, Y:0.14,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 6315091.
